Speak with Beasts and Plants. The Amethyst Elephant Druid can communicate with beasts and plants as if they shared a language.
Channel Ancestral Form. Amethyst Elephants can temporarily transform into their ancient beast form, the Amethyst Elephant (Beast Form). This transformation lasts for 1 hour, after which they revert back to their original form. Once they use this ability, they cannot do so again until they finish a long rest.
Spellcasting. The druid is a 12th-level spellcaster. Its spellcasting ability is Wisdom (spell save DC 16, +8 to hit with spell attacks). It has the following druid spells prepared:
Cantrips (at will): druidcraft, Blight Fire, resistance, thorn whip
1st level (4 slots): cure wounds, Destroy Blight, thunderwave
2nd level (3 slots): beast sense, Amethyst Sanctuary, pass without trace
3rd level (3 slots): conjure animals, dispel magic, plant growth
4th level (2 slots): freedom of movement, Light of Diminishment
Quarterstaff. Melee Weapon Attack: +5 to hit (+7 to hit with shillelagh), reach 5 ft., one target. Hit: 5 (1d6 + 2) bludgeoning damage, or 6 (1d8 + 2) bludgeoning damage if wielded with two hands, or 9 (1d8 + 4) bludgeoning damage with shillelagh.
Description
The Amethyst Elephant Druids are protectors of the Amethyst Isle, channeling the ancient power of their legendary ancestor, Behi Mot Barum. These wise and mighty guardians use their druidic magic to heal and defend the land, wielding the strength of nature against threats like the Blighted Scourge. In battle, they can temporarily transform into their primal beast form, embodying the raw might of their ancestral lineage to protect the sacred Isle.
